Question about the envo map
As far as I know the envoirment mapping is created by using the alpha channel of the *-shine map of a texture.
I now got the problem that this map seams to be completly ignored. No differance if its near white or near black I still get a strong reflection that makes the ship look like its made out of glass.

I am using TGA textures for testing and will later compress them into DDS format. So an alpha channel should be used and saved with the texture. What could I do wrong?

I guess that black means no reflection and white reflective.

Re: Question about the envo map
Do you have the 'Experimental' launcher flag 'Use specular alpha for env mapping' enabled?
